Small ecommerce businesses looking for customer feedback platforms often compare POWR, Grapevine Surveys, and KnoCommerce. Each caters to Shopify merchants but targets slightly different feedback collection needs, from general surveys and popups to detailed post-purchase attribution. This article evaluates their strengths and weaknesses to help identify the best fit.

Core Features and Functionality

POWR offers a Shopify form builder that includes customizable surveys, popups, and lead capture forms. It provides versatility for collecting varied types of customer feedback and can be embedded in many site locations. However, it is broader in scope and not specialized for post-purchase feedback specifically.

Grapevine Surveys focuses on collecting customer feedback on the order status page with post-purchase surveys. It is designed to capture quick insights immediately after purchase, which can be valuable for order experience improvements. The app is limited to this specific placement and type of feedback.

KnoCommerce specializes in post-purchase attribution surveys with multi-question flows. It emphasizes zero-party data collection, allowing merchants to build detailed customer profiles based on explicit customer input. Its survey flows can be customized to capture rich data beyond simple satisfaction ratings.

Ease of Setup and Use

POWR is straightforward for merchants familiar with Shopify apps. Its drag-and-drop form builder and templates simplify initial setup, but deep customization requires some learning.

Grapevine Surveys requires minimal setup, focusing on a single survey type and placement. It is user-friendly for merchants wanting quick deployment without configuring complex flows.

KnoCommerce setup is more involved due to multi-question flows and targeting options. It may require more time to fine-tune surveys but offers higher data quality and segmentation options.

Integrations

All three integrate directly with Shopify. POWR also supports other platforms like Wix and WordPress, making it more flexible for merchants with multi-platform needs.

Grapevine Surveys and KnoCommerce focus on Shopify integration only, reflecting their niche post-purchase feedback positioning.

None of the three have broad third-party app integrations beyond Shopify, which may limit workflow automation outside the platform.

Situational Recommendations

If your small ecommerce business needs a flexible form builder with survey and lead capture options across multiple platforms, POWR is a solid foundation. It balances price and features but requires some setup effort to get advanced surveys running.

If your primary goal is quick post-purchase feedback on Shopify with minimal hassle, Grapevine Surveys offers focused value at a low price. It lacks multi-question flows but covers essential feedback collection well.

For merchants focused on customer attribution and deep post-purchase insights, KnoCommerce justifies its higher cost with rich data collection capabilities and survey customization. It suits those ready to invest in zero-party data strategies.
